Abstract
In this paper, the effects of additives, complex agents and current densities on thetexture and grain size of the zinc deposits from zincate baths are studied by means of X ray diffraction. The results show that the existence of additive AA-1 causes the preferential orientation of (101) face; when DIE is added alone, the preferential orientation changes to (110) face; with additives both DIE and AA-1, Zn deposits with highly preferential orientation of (110) are obtained in a certain range of current densities, and if complex agents TEA and EDTA are simultaneously existed, fine granular and bright Zn deposits with highly preferential orientation can be obtained in the wider range of current densities.
